The Stockholm Center for Eating Disorders (SCÄ) is one of the largest specialist clinics in the world for patients with eating disorders, accepting patients of all ages.

We have a well-developed operation with digital care, outpatient care, intensive outpatient care, day care, full-time care, and nationally specialized care for both adults, children, and adolescents. Today, we have over 280 employees. Our outpatient and day care services are located in Södermalm, and our full-time care is at Danderyd Hospital.

For patient-related work within the Stockholm County Healthcare Area:

  • background checks are applied before hiring decisions according to SLSO's overarching instructions for background checks during employment.
  • employees who will have patient contact must undergo a pre-employment medical examination, according to current directives, which is conducted through occupational health services before employment.
  • in addition to Swedish professional certification, good knowledge of the Swedish language at level C1 according to the Common European Framework of Reference (CEFR) is required. The same requirements apply to non-licensed personnel with patient contact.

Stockholm County Healthcare Area (SLSO) is one of Sweden's largest healthcare providers with 11,600 employees. We offer health and medical care under the auspices of Region Stockholm in psychiatry, primary care, geriatrics, ASIH, urgent care, somatic specialist care, habilitation and health, and aids. In collaboration with Karolinska Institute, we conduct research, education, and development. https://www.slso.regionstockholm.se/ (https://www.slso.regionstockholm.se/).
